When thinking about Industrial And Urban Wastewater Treatment , many people do not realize how much influence it has on daily life. Clean water flowing through cities and industries is not an accident—it is the product of careful design, chemistry, and constant attention. Drivers, business owners, and city residents all benefit from water that is safe, clear, and reliable, even if they never see the processes behind the scenes.

Treatment works in layers. Suspended solids are removed, chemicals adjust content, and microorganisms can process remaining organic material. Finally, filtration ensures clarity, leaving water ready for reuse or release. The combination of these steps creates a predictable, stable flow that supports both human activity and the environment. Even small adjustments can have noticeable effects on efficiency and water quality.

People often underestimate the visual and social impact of proper treatment. Streets, rivers, and reservoirs appear cleaner, odors are reduced, and overall urban life feels more pleasant. Businesses benefit because water can be reused in production processes, and communities enjoy the peace of mind that comes from reliable infrastructure. Industrial And Urban Wastewater Treatment is more than a technical process—it is a foundation for health, comfort, and aesthetic quality.

Flexibility is another advantage. Systems that adjust to different types of industrial waste or fluctuating urban flows allow operators to respond quickly to changing conditions. Improved chemical application, flow control, and monitoring ensure that water remains within desired quality levels without excessive manual intervention. These solutions provide both safety and convenience, enhancing overall efficiency.

The long-term perspective is important. Facilities that invest in proper treatment practices often see better resource management, reduced environmental impact, and increased public trust. Smooth, reliable operation ensures consistent performance, while careful selection of chemicals and polymers minimizes waste and supports sustainability. It is a thoughtful approach that balances operational needs with environmental responsibility.
